
I recently worked on some Warhammer Flagellants for my Empire army. While pulling them out, I looked at a few archer models that where in the same tray. Once the Flagellants were done, I put them away and pulled out the archers. There were only ten models and they needed a bit of work. I bought them a long time ago and they had a very basic paint job. They were done in blue and white scheme. The white was not really shaded and the blue only had highlights.

I had decided quite some time ago to update my Empire paint scheme and move it from the two color blue/white scheme to a three color re/white/blue scheme (this was Altdorf in the old world). Being a small unit, this seemed to be a good unit to try the look. The figures also let me try out the new GW contrast paints, that I had been meaning to work with!

So, I basically hit the white with the new contrast paint and then again painted the highlights. I used the blood red on some sections of white and also hit them with a red highlight. I was very happy with the effect and it definitely sped things up! I decided to hit the blue recesses to darken them up a bit and give more contrast to the blue. I followed this up with some repainting of hats and feathers. I now have a redone archer unit and a path forward for the rest of the army!
